Group Home

In order to establish a Group Home or Adult Living Facility (ALF) in the unincorporated areas of Miami‐Dade County for a maximum of 6 persons, operators will need to submit a Group Home/ALF Application to confirm that there are no other legally established facilities within a 1,000 feet radius of the proposed site. If the requirements are met, the site will be reserved for 6 months in order to enable the applicant to complete the State of Florida licensing requirements. The fee is $237.77. The State of Florida requires a spacing verification letter indicating compliance with zoning regulations prior to obtaining a State license. 

What is a Group Home? A dwelling unit licensed by the State of Florida (State) to serve resident clients and which provides a living environment for not more than 6 unrelated residents who operate as a functional equivalent of a family. Supervisory and supportive staff as may be necessary to meet the physical, emotional and social needs of the resident clients shall be excluded in said count (Miami-Dade County Zoning Code, Section 33-1[53.1])*. ALFs are considered Group Homes.

A group home shall be permitted in a dwelling unit provided:

  • That the total number of resident clients on the premises not exceeds 6 in number.
  • That the operation of the facility be licensed by the State.
  • That the structure used for a group home shall be located at least 1,000 feet from another existing, unabandoned legally established group home.

How do I obtain a Zoning Verification Letter for a 6-month site reservation to establish a Group Home/ALF?

Complete the Group Home/ALF application to obtain a zoning verification letter for a six-month site reservation from the Regulatory & Economic Resources Department. The form may also be obtained at department offices at the Stephen P. Clark Center, 111 NW 1st Street, 11th Floor, Miami, FL.

Instructions for submitting a Group Home/ALF Application:

The Department will review the application packet for completeness and will not accept a package that is incomplete. Applications are processed on a first-come, first-served basis; the Department does not have a wait list. See below for instructions.

• Application for a New Group Home/ALF:

  1. A brief letter of intent to explain the type of application being requested (new home, operator or owner change, etc.) accompanied by this form signed by the applicant/operator.
  2. Payment of $237.77 in money order or cashier's check made payable to Miami-Dade County.
  3. The property owner’s affidavit of consent (signed, witnessed and notarized) to use the property for a group home. If there is more than one owner then all owners must sign the affidavit.
  4. A legible photocopy of the proposed operator’s and property owner(s) driver's licenses.
  5. A spacing survey in substantially the same form as the sample provided prepared, signed and sealed by a licensed surveyor certifying that there are no other legally established group homes within 1,000 feet of the proposed group home. Please be advised that your spacing survey will likely only reflect the spacing from group homes already licensed by the State of Florida.  The Department will also consider the list of group home properties that are reserved in the Miami-Dade County Group Home database which can change on a daily basis.

If the site complies with Zoning and spacing regulations, the Department will issue a zoning verification letter to the applicant within ten (10) working days indicating the site's compliance or non-compliance with Zoning Code regulations

A site with a closed/expired license will be treated as a new site and must comply with the 1,000-foot spacing requirement, as well as all other requirements for a new group home reservation.

• Request for an Extension
If you need additional time to obtain your license from the State, you must submit a request for an extension at least 15 days before the six-month reservation expires. An extension request must include Items #1 through 4 above, including payment of $237.77 in money order or cashier's check made out to Miami-Dade County.

The letter of intent must explain the reason for the delay, and include the following documentation: proof of application for the State license and copies of building permits, including inspection results. Failure to timely request an extension could result in the removal of the site's "reserved" status. The Department will not reserve a site for more than two consecutive six-month periods.

• Name Change / Operator Change
A request for a name change or operator change on a site will require Items #1 through 4 above, including a processing fee of $237.77 in money order or cashier's check made out to Miami-Dade County. In order to make such a change, the State’s internet site must show a licensing status of open/active. The applicant shall have 180 days to complete the change/transfer.


Once you receive your license from the state, you must submit a copy to the department. Failure to submit a copy of your license to the department prior to the expiration of your reservation could result in the release of your reservation and failure to comply with zoning regulations.

Please be aware that it is your responsibility to adhere to the deadlines and submittal requirements.

If an application for a site reservation does not comply with spacing or other Zoning regulations, the applicant may seek to obtain approval as a special exception at a public hearing. The application for a zoning hearing may be obtained at 111 NW 1st Street, 11th Floor. Said application will be heard by the Community Council of the area and the Council will determine whether or not to approve the request.
